CITY OF COVINGTON CITY COUNCIL MEETING AGENDA
MONDAY, OCTOBER 21, 2024
5:30 PM: WORK SESSION - Discussion of Downtown murals, signage, and furniture
6:30 PM: COUNCIL MEETING
2116 STALLINGS STREET | COVINGTON, GA 30014
Expected Attendants - Mayor Fleeta Baggett, Mayor Pro-tem Susie Keck, Council members: Anthony Henderson, Kimberly Johnson, Travis Moore, Charika Davis, and Jared Rutberg, City Manager Tres Thomas, Deputy City Manager John King, City Clerk Audra M. Gutierrez, and City Attorney Frank Turner, Jr.
1. Call to order, invocation, and Pledge of Allegiance to the Flag of the United States of America.
UNFINISHED BUSINESS
2. Discussion of the minutes from the Regular Council Meeting held on October 7, 2024.
NEW BUSINESS
3. Discussion of changes to the agenda.
4. CONSENT AGENDA
4a. Approval of application to sell alcoholic beverages for off-premises consumption only for:
Covington Super Mart: 8108 Washington Street
4b. Approval of application to sell alcoholic beverages for on-premises consumption only for:
Blockers Sports Bar & Grill LLC: 2145 Pace Street, Ste C
5. Ms. Nita Thompson to discuss provisioning for firefighters.
6. Discussion of a Special Use Permit to allow a Specialty Contractor with Outdoor Storage to be located at 8460 Dr. Martin Luther King Jr Ave.
7. Discussion of a Special Use Permit to allow a Place of Worship on greater than 10 acres (Sec. 16.20.570) and includes a request for relief to Sec. 16.20.570.A to be located at 70 McGuirts Bridge Road.
8. Discussion of public hearing for a city-initiated text amendment to Sec. 16.20.135 - Breweries, brewpubs and distilleries, for the purpose of revisiting requirements. This may also include updates to Sec. 16.08.010 – Definitions
9. Discussion of public hearing for a city-initiated text amendment amending Auto Use to allow in M2 zoning which may also include updates or additions to definitions and/or supplemental use provisions. Amendment to Ordinance Sections include: Chapter 16.08 Definitions; Sec. 16.16.020; and Sec. 16.20.480.
10. Discussion of request from the Engineering Department to waive the competitive bid process and award A & S Paving Inc. the CMP Replacement Masterplan – Capital Improvement Project - B, Construction Phase 2A.
11. Discussion of RFQ for the CPD Pistol Range Building.
12. Discussion of ECG Year End Settlement and Contract Payment reimbursement - $12,179.38.
13. Discussion of proposed 2025 City Council Meeting calendar.
14. Public Comments.
15. Comments from the City Manager.
16. Comments from the Mayor and Council.
17. Adjourn.
